Playing Bradford Beach, Milwaukee
Bradford Beach faces east onto Lake Michigan, so a cooling lake breeze off the water is the day's main variable, often strengthening through warm afternoons. As on the rest of the Great Lakes, fronts moving across the region can bring gustier, more variable wind than a steady ocean sea breeze, so conditions shift more day to day. Mornings tend to be the calmest, and the season runs roughly June through September.

Does SpikeWeather show tide at Bradford Beach?
No — Lake Michigan has no meaningful tide, so there's no tide gauge here and no tide readout. Wave height still appears, since the lake builds real chop on a windy day.
Why do conditions shift so much day to day here?
Fronts moving across the region can bring gustier, more variable wind than a steady ocean sea breeze, so two consecutive days can read very differently. The lake breeze off the water is the calmer, more predictable half of the picture.
When does the Bradford Beach season run?
Roughly June through September, with the water and air both needing the summer to warm up. Mornings tend to be the calmest part of a playable day.
